The Art of Urban Tree Management: Balancing Growth and Infrastructure
In urban areas, trees often face numerous challenges such as limited space, pollution, and human activity. The proximity to infrastructure like buildings, roads, and utility lines can lead to conflicts that need careful planning and management. A key aspect of this balance is strategic planting and proper selection of tree species. Not all trees are suitable for urban areas, where root and canopy space may be restricted. Choosing the right species that can thrive in limited spaces without compromising infrastructure is essential. Pruning is another crucial component of urban tree management. Regular pruning not only maintains the health and safety of trees but also prevents limbs from interfering with utility lines and buildings. Furthermore, urban tree management requires careful monitoring of tree health. Trees in urban environments are susceptible to pests, diseases, and environmental stressors. Routine inspections by arborists help detect early signs of stress or disease, enabling timely interventions that can prolong the life and health of urban trees. Another vital element is community involvement. Engaging local communities in tree planting and care initiatives fosters a sense of ownership and stewardship for the urban environment. When residents are educated about the benefits of trees and involved in their maintenance, the overall commitment to protecting these green assets increases.
